Journalists perform an indispensable role in informing local community members about the events happening around them. The First Amendment protects journalists’ freedom to gather and report the news wherever it takes place publicly. Therefore, it was deeply troubling to see attacks on journalists across the country – including by law enforcement – while they were on the ground reporting on the protests following the death of George Floyd. In response to these recent events, last week Representatives Mary Gay Scanlon (D-PA) and Adam Schiff (D-CA) introduced a House Resolution reaffirming the First Amendment right to freedom of the press and calling for the protection of journalists by government officials and law enforcement.
